Warehouse Demolition in Sacramento, CA
Warehouse demolition services involve the safe and efficient removal of large industrial or commercial structures, including warehouses, storage facilities, and similar buildings. These projects typically include tearing down the entire structure, dismantling interior components, and clearing the site for future use or redevelopment. Property owners often seek this service when repurposing land, upgrading facilities, or removing outdated or damaged buildings that no longer serve their needs.
Before requesting warehouse demolition, property owners should understand the scope of work involved, including site preparation, debris removal, and potential permits or regulations that may apply. It’s also important to consider the condition of the structure, the presence of hazardous materials, and any specific site constraints that could impact the project.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ure the demolition process proceeds smoothly and safely.

Common Warehouse Demolition Jobs
Warehouse Demolition - Complete removal of old or unused warehouse structures from the property.
Industrial Building Demolition - Safe dismantling of large-scale industrial facilities for redevelopment or clearance.
Interior Warehouse Strip-Outs - Removal of interior fixtures, shelving, and equipment to prepare for renovation.
Selective Demolition - Targeted removal of specific sections or features within a warehouse to meet project needs.
Site Clearing and Debris Removal - Clearing the site of debris and leftover materials after demolition work.
Structural Demolition - Demolition of load-bearing walls and structural elements to facilitate building modifications.
Warehouse Demolition Questions
What types of warehouses are suitable for demolition? Any commercial or industrial warehouse structure can be dismantled, regardless of size or construction materials.
Is preparation needed before demolition? Property owners should clear the area of personal belongings and ensure access to the site for equipment.
Are there any permits required for warehouse demolition? Local regulations typically require permits, and it’s important to verify with the relevant authorities before starting.
What materials are commonly removed during demolition? Items such as metal, concrete, wood, and other building materials are typically dismantled and recycled or disposed of properly.
